> The documentation at 
> http://activemq.apache.org/shared-file-system-master-slave.html says that 
> OCFS2 does not work, saying 
> "OCFS2 only supports locking with 'fcntl' and not 'lockf and flock', 
> therefore mutex file locking from Java isn't supported." 
> However, based on my reading of the OpenJDK source, Java uses fcntl, not 
> flock and this statement is incorrect.
